Afterwards, we will recommend another software that you can use to rip the DVDs, or one you can use for playback.<\/p>\n<div class=\"tc2\"><a href=\"https:\/\/www.leawo.org\/tutorial\/wp-content\/uploads\/2021\/08\/surface-pro-external-dvd-drive.jpg\" onClick=\"return hs.expand(this)\"><img decoding=\"async\" data-src=\"https:\/\/www.leawo.org\/tutorial\/wp-content\/uploads\/2021\/08\/surface-pro-external-dvd-drive.jpg\" title=\"dvd to microsoft surface\" alt=\"dvd to microsoft surface\" width=\"600\" src=\"data:image\/svg+xml;base64,PHN2ZyB3aWR0aD0iMSIgaGVpZ2h0PSIxIiB4bWxucz0iaHR0cDovL3d3dy53My5vcmcvMjAwMC9zdmciPjwvc3ZnPg==\" class=\"lazyload\" \/><\/a><\/div>\n<p>Therefore, to connect and use an external Surface Pro DVD drive, follow the steps below;<\/p>\n<p><b>Step 1:<\/b> Connect the external optical drive to your Microsoft Surface computer, by plugging it in via USB. If the external disc drive requires a connection to power, you should also ensure that you have done so.<\/p>\n<p><b>Step 2:<\/b> Allow Windows to install the necessary drivers. When you have connected the device, Windows will download and install the necessary drivers in the background, and when it finishes it will tell you that the device is ready for use.<\/p>\n<p><b>Step 3:<\/b> Play your DVD movies.
